1.使用交叉关联查询(CROSS JOIN):
SELECT * FROM table1 CROSS JOIN table2 WHERE table1.column1 = table2.column2;
2.使用子查询(Subquery):
SELECT * FROM table1 WHERE column1 IN (SELECT column2 FROM table2);
3.使用EXISTS运算符:
SELECT * FROM table1 WHERE EXISTS (SELECT column2 FROM table2 WHERE table2.column2 = table1.column1);
4.使用NOT EXISTS运算符:
SELECT * FROM table1 WHERE NOT EXISTS (SELECT column2 FROM table2 WHERE table2.column2 = table1.column1);
上一篇:不使用任何循环逆转一个整数数组
下一篇:不使用任何预定义C函数的位运算